WebbNahua. The Nahua people are the largest indigenous group in Mexico today. They live in villages and towns throughout Central Mexico and speak at least one variant of language in the Nahua language ... With ancestry going back at least 1,000 years to the time of the Aztecs, Chihuahuas are long-time residents of Mexico. WebbMexico's population still contains many Indian groups. Depending on the definition used, the total number of Indians varied from 6.7 million to 10 million in 1995. The most significant groups are the Nahuas, Otomís, Mayas, Zapotecas, Mixtecos, Tzeltales, and Tzotziles. Linguistic Affiliation. WebbOne of Mexico’s prominent geographical features is the world’s longest peninsula, the 775-mile-long Baja California Peninsula, which lies between the Pacific Ocean and the Gulf of California (also known as the Sea of Cortez). The Baja California Peninsula includes a series of mountain ranges called the Peninsular Ranges. incheon clearance

Mexico City is sinking every year because 70 percent of the water people rely on has been pumped out from the aquifer beneath the city. 34. The country is a paradise for history buffs, as it’s home to 37,266 registered archeological sites! 35. Mexico is the most populous Spanish-speaking country in the world.

Webb23 apr. 2012 · The 2006 demographic survey shows about 274,000 people who had lived outside of Mexico in 2001 and had returned to Mexico by 2006. The number was notably higher in the 2009 demographic survey—about 667,000 people who had lived in the U.S. in 2004 and had gone to Mexico in 2004-2009. Mexican Census Results Help Explain …

Webb2 jan. 2024 · 35. Xtabentun Liquor Souvenir. The crafting of this liquor—distinctive of the Yucatan region—has been perfected by the Mayans for the last 1,000 years. Xtabentun is a liquor that’s wholly unique to the Riveria Maya region. Xtabentun is made from fermented honey and anise and rum, best enjoyed straight over ice. 36.

The Pryors are famous for their "fairy rings" and strange happenings. Some members of the Crow tribe consider the little people to be sacred ancestors and require leaving an offering for them upon entry to the area. incheon coffeeWebb11 apr. 2024 · Here are some rapid fire facts about the cost of living in Mexico.
